Spirit Audio Recording : Picking the Best Equipment
Venturing into the world of paranormal audio investigation requires more than a basic device. To effectively capture potential EVP’s (Electronic Voice Phenomena) and other unexplained sounds , informed selection of your audio instruments is critical . Consider a specialized digital audio recorder with a minimal self-noise level – this will help reduce unwanted background static. External pickups are typically preferable to built-in ones, offering better sensitivity and sound . Additionally , a high-quality external booster can significantly enhance faint signal output.

Advanced Audio Technology for Ghost Hunting & EVP Capture
The pursuit of paranormal evidence often relies heavily on specialized audio equipment. Modern ghost investigators are increasingly leveraging innovative techniques to record Electronic Voice Phenomena (EVP) and other faint audio clues. Electronic recorders with exceptional dynamic range and quiet preamps are now vital for eliminating background noise and maximizing the chance of discovering potentially paranormal utterances. Furthermore, directional audio pickups, like parabolic dishes and binaural pairs, allow for focused audio collection and identifying the direction of strange sounds. Programs for audio processing can then be employed to improve recordings, revealing details otherwise lost.
- Utilizing noise reduction methods
- Applying spectral examination
- Analyzing frequencies outside the typical hearing range
